Two Nudes in the Lake (Zwei Akte im See)
Paul Klee (German, born Switzerland. 1879–1940)
1907. Etching and drypoint, plate: 4 3/4 x 4 11/16" (12 x 11.9 cm); sheet (irreg.): 11 7/16 x 8 3/16" (29 x 20.8 cm). Purchase
Collection work meeting criteria specified in Introduction.
588.1942
Galerie Der Sturm, Berlin; to Heinrich Stinnes (1876-1932), Cologne, June 12, 1917; Heinrich Stinnes Estate; sold through Gutekunst & Klipstein, June 20-22, 1938.
Curt Valentin, New York,?; to The Museum of Modern Art, New York, 1942
